Colleen Murphy 2ac38b2256 Fix template variables
Using ruby methods to access manifest variables is deprecated in puppet
3 and will be removed in puppet 4. This patch fixes the templates to
use ruby instance variables instead.

OpenStack Redis Module

Marton Kiss marton.kiss@gmail.com Sebastian Marcet smarcet@gmail.com

Quick Start

To install Redis server and configure it with defaults, include the following in your manifest file:

class { 'redis':
}

Configuration

This module supports redis version 2.2.x, 2.4.x and 2.6.x on Ubuntu Operation Systems.

Redis server

class { 'redis':
  redis_port        => '6379',
  redis_bind        => '127.0.0.1',
  redis_password    => 'mys3cr3tpassw0rd',
  redis_max_memory  => '1gb',
  version           => '2.2.12',
}

NOTE: you must specify the package version number, because the configuration templates are different for major redis versions.
